[Adopted 7-9-1984 by Ord. No. A-12-84 as Ch. 146, Art. IV, of the 1984 Code]
A. 
No person shall resist any police officer or member of the Police Department in the discharge of his duties or in any way interfere with or hinder him from discharging his duties as such officer or member or threaten him or attempt so to do.
B. 
No person shall in any manner assist any person in the custody of any police officer or member of the Police Department to escape or attempt to escape from such custody or attempt to rescue any person so in custody.
C. 
No person shall, while operating a motor vehicle on any street or highway in the City of Rahway, knowingly flee or attempt to elude any police or law enforcement officer after having received a signal from such officer to bring the vehicle to a full stop.
Any person who violates any provision of this article shall, upon conviction thereof, be punished by a fine not exceeding $500 or by imprisonment for a term not exceeding 90 days, or both.
